A woman from British Columbia has formed an unlikely and heartwarming friendship with an octopus, describing the creature as “like an underwater puppy.”

The woman, who prefers to remain anonymous, first encountered the octopus while diving in the waters off the coast of Vancouver Island. She was immediately drawn to the curious and playful nature of the octopus, and the two quickly formed a bond.

Over the course of several months, the woman would visit the octopus in its natural habitat, spending hours observing and interacting with the creature. She even began bringing the octopus treats, such as crabs and shrimp, which it eagerly accepted.

The woman’s relationship with the octopus has been captured in a viral video, which shows the two playing and interacting in the water. The video has garnered attention from people all over the world, with many expressing their awe and admiration for the unique friendship.

But beyond the heartwarming aspect of this story, there is also a deeper message about the importance of respecting and protecting marine life. The woman hopes that her experience with the octopus will inspire others to appreciate and care for the creatures that inhabit our oceans.

In an interview with CTV News, the woman emphasized the intelligence and individuality of the octopus, stating that “they’re not just a slimy creature, they’re very intelligent and they have personalities.”
